About Bharani Chava

Bharani Chava is a scholar working on Electrical and Electronic Engineering, Electronic, Optical and Magnetic Materials, Biomedical Engineering, Computer Networks and Communications and Atomic and Molecular Physics, and Optics, having authored 15 papers that have together received 301 indexed citations. Recurring topics across this work include 3D IC and TSV technologies (7 papers), Semiconductor materials and devices (7 papers), Advancements in Photolithography Techniques (4 papers), Advancements in Semiconductor Devices and Circuit Design (3 papers), Low-power high-performance VLSI design (3 papers), Integrated Circuits and Semiconductor Failure Analysis (3 papers), Nanofabrication and Lithography Techniques (2 papers) and Electromagnetic Compatibility and Noise Suppression (2 papers). The work is most often cited by research in Hardware and Architecture (52 citations), Electrical and Electronic Engineering (278 citations), Industrial and Manufacturing Engineering (14 citations), Electronic, Optical and Magnetic Materials (22 citations) and Biomedical Engineering (30 citations). Bharani Chava has collaborated with scholars based in Belgium, United States and Germany. Frequent co-authors include Julien Ryckaert, Diederik Verkest, Eric Beyne, Geert Van der Plas, Anshul Gupta, Peter Debacker, Anne Jourdain, A. Spessot, Muhannad S. Bakir and Praveen Raghavan. Their work appears in journals such as Journal of Micro/Nanolithography MEMS and MOEMS, IEEE Electron Device Letters, IEEE Transactions on Electron Devices, Proceedings of SPIE, the International Society for Optical Engineering/Proceedings of SPIE and Zenodo (CERN European Organization for Nuclear Research).
